Essential Considerations for a Zumba Fitness Ensemble

The selection of appropriate attire and accessories is crucial for maximizing the benefits and minimizing the risks associated with Zumba fitness activities. Prioritizing functionality and comfort will contribute to a more effective and enjoyable workout.

Tip 1: Prioritize Breathable Fabrics: Opt for clothing constructed from moisture-wicking materials such as polyester blends or merino wool. These fabrics facilitate ventilation and help regulate body temperature during intense physical activity.

Tip 2: Choose Flexible Apparel: Select clothing that allows for a full range of motion. Avoid restrictive garments that may impede movement or cause discomfort during the various Zumba routines.

Tip 3: Invest in Supportive Footwear: Footwear designed for dance fitness activities is essential. Look for shoes with adequate cushioning, lateral support, and a non-marking sole to protect joints and prevent injuries.

Tip 4: Consider Layering Options: Depending on the environment, layering clothing can be beneficial. A lightweight jacket or wrap can be added or removed as needed to maintain a comfortable body temperature.

Tip 5: Ensure Proper Fit: Clothing that is too loose may pose a tripping hazard, while overly tight garments can restrict movement. Select items that fit comfortably and securely without impeding performance.

Tip 6: Assess Support Needs: For individuals requiring additional support, a high-impact sports bra is recommended. Adequate support is essential for minimizing discomfort and potential injuries.

Tip 7: Focus on Undergarments: Select supportive, moisture-wicking undergarments that will not cause chafing or discomfort during extended periods of physical activity.

By adhering to these recommendations, individuals can optimize their Zumba fitness experience, enhancing both performance and enjoyment. Thoughtful attention to the selection of clothing and accessories is a key component of a safe and effective workout regimen.

2. Supportive athletic footwear

2. Supportive Athletic Footwear, Workout

The inclusion of supportive athletic footwear within a Zumba workout set is not merely a matter of accessory selection; it constitutes a fundamental component directly impacting participant safety and performance. The dynamic and high-impact nature of Zumba routines places considerable stress on the lower extremities. Footwear lacking adequate support can precipitate a cascade of adverse effects, ranging from minor discomfort to severe musculoskeletal injuries.

The primary purpose of supportive athletic footwear in this context is to provide sufficient cushioning to absorb impact forces generated during jumps, pivots, and other rapid movements. Furthermore, lateral support is critical for maintaining stability during side-to-side motions, mitigating the risk of ankle sprains and other lateral instabilities. Consider the example of a participant performing a high-energy Zumba routine on a hard surface. Without appropriate cushioning, the repetitive impact forces can lead to stress fractures or plantar fasciitis. Similarly, inadequate lateral support can result in an ankle injury if the foot rolls inward or outward during a quick change of direction. Proper footwear, in contrast, helps to distribute these forces evenly, reducing stress on joints and ligaments.

In summation, the functional relationship between supportive athletic footwear and the Zumba workout set is one of direct cause and effect. Lack of appropriate footwear can lead to injury and diminished performance, whereas the implementation of properly designed athletic shoes provides essential support, stability, and shock absorption, thereby optimizing the overall safety and effectiveness of the Zumba experience. Prioritizing this element within the workout set is, therefore, a practical and essential consideration.

3. Proper moisture management

3. Proper Moisture Management, Workout

Efficient moisture management is an indispensable aspect of the optimal Zumba fitness experience. The dynamic and often high-intensity nature of these workouts necessitates apparel that effectively wicks away perspiration, thereby maintaining comfort and preventing potential health risks. The integration of moisture-wicking properties into a Zumba ensemble represents a critical functional consideration.

  • Fabric Composition and Wicking Action

    Fabrics engineered for moisture management, such as polyester microfibers and synthetic blends, possess inherent wicking capabilities. These materials draw moisture away from the skin’s surface and facilitate evaporation, keeping the wearer drier and more comfortable. In contrast, natural fibers like cotton tend to absorb moisture, becoming heavy and retaining dampness, which can lead to discomfort and chafing during prolonged physical activity. The choice of fabric directly impacts the efficiency of moisture management.

  • Temperature Regulation and Comfort

    Effective moisture management directly influences the body’s ability to regulate temperature during a Zumba workout. By facilitating the evaporation of sweat, moisture-wicking apparel helps to prevent overheating and maintain a more stable core body temperature. This translates to enhanced comfort and reduced risk of heat-related illness, particularly during workouts conducted in warm or humid environments. Retaining a comfortable body temperature allows for sustained physical activity and optimized performance.

  • Odor Control and Hygiene

    Perspiration can contribute to the development of unpleasant odors due to bacterial growth. Moisture-wicking fabrics often incorporate antimicrobial treatments to inhibit bacterial proliferation, thereby mitigating odor accumulation. Enhanced hygiene and odor control contribute to a more pleasant and confident workout experience, reducing self-consciousness and promoting social interaction within a group fitness setting.

  • Skin Health and Irritation Prevention

    Prolonged exposure to damp clothing can lead to skin irritation, chafing, and an increased risk of fungal infections. Moisture-wicking apparel helps to maintain a drier skin environment, reducing the likelihood of these adverse effects. Proper moisture management is particularly important for individuals with sensitive skin or pre-existing skin conditions. By minimizing moisture-related skin issues, moisture-wicking clothing contributes to overall skin health and comfort during Zumba workouts.

4. Unrestricted range of motion

4. Unrestricted Range Of Motion, Workout

Unrestricted range of motion is a fundamental criterion for an effective Zumba workout set. The choreography characteristic of Zumba involves a diverse array of movements, encompassing broad lateral steps, expansive arm extensions, and dynamic hip articulations. Apparel that inhibits these movements directly compromises a participant’s ability to execute routines correctly and safely.

The cause-and-effect relationship is clear: restrictive clothing impedes the full expression of Zumba’s dance-based fitness regimen. For example, wearing stiff or tightly fitted jeans would prevent the fluid hip movements crucial to many Latin-inspired steps, leading to potential strain on the lower back and reduced workout efficacy. Conversely, a set comprising flexible leggings and a loose-fitting top allows for complete freedom of movement, maximizing the benefits of the exercise while minimizing the risk of injury. The importance of this aspect is not merely about comfort; it is integral to achieving the intended cardiovascular and musculoskeletal gains of Zumba.

The practical significance of understanding this connection lies in informed purchasing decisions. Individuals should prioritize fabrics with high elasticity and designs that accommodate a wide range of motion. The ability to perform squats, lunges, and twists without restriction should serve as a primary indicator of suitability. By prioritizing unrestricted range of motion in the selection of a Zumba workout set, participants can significantly enhance both the enjoyment and the effectiveness of their fitness endeavors.

5. Appropriate layering options

5. Appropriate Layering Options, Workout

The strategic utilization of layering within a Zumba workout set addresses the fluctuations in body temperature inherent in the activity. This adaptive approach allows for optimal comfort and performance regardless of environmental conditions or individual metabolic variations.

  • Initial Warm-Up Phase

    During the initial warm-up phase of a Zumba session, a lightweight outer layer, such as a breathable jacket or wrap, can help to retain body heat and prepare the muscles for more strenuous activity. This layer serves to prevent premature cooling, which can increase the risk of muscle strain or injury. As the body temperature rises, this outer layer can be easily removed and stored, allowing for greater freedom of movement and ventilation.

  • High-Intensity Intervals

    Throughout the high-intensity intervals of a Zumba workout, the body generates significant heat. Apparel designed to wick moisture away from the skin becomes essential to maintain comfort and prevent overheating. A base layer consisting of moisture-wicking fabrics helps to regulate body temperature by facilitating the evaporation of sweat. The addition of a lightweight, breathable top layer can provide additional coverage without impeding ventilation.

  • Cool-Down Period

    During the cool-down period, body temperature gradually decreases. A lightweight outer layer can again be employed to prevent excessive cooling, which can lead to muscle stiffness or discomfort. This layer should be easily accessible and capable of providing insulation without restricting movement. The layering strategy during the cool-down phase promotes a gradual transition back to a resting state.

  • Environmental Adaptability

    Layering options enhance the adaptability of a Zumba workout set to varying environmental conditions. In cooler climates, additional layers can be added to provide greater insulation. In warmer climates, fewer layers can be worn to maximize ventilation and minimize the risk of overheating. This flexibility allows individuals to tailor their apparel to suit the specific environment, ensuring optimal comfort and performance regardless of external factors.

Frequently Asked Questions

This section addresses common inquiries and clarifies misconceptions regarding the selection and utilization of a Zumba workout set, providing evidence-based guidance for optimizing the exercise experience.

Question 1: What distinguishes a Zumba-specific workout set from general athletic apparel?

A Zumba-specific workout set is characterized by its emphasis on flexibility, breathability, and moisture-wicking properties, tailored to the dynamic movements and elevated body temperatures inherent in Zumba routines. General athletic apparel may not adequately address these specific requirements, potentially compromising comfort and performance.

Question 2: Is specialized footwear truly necessary, or can standard athletic shoes suffice?

While standard athletic shoes may offer some degree of support and cushioning, specialized footwear designed for dance fitness activities provides enhanced lateral support and pivot points, crucial for minimizing the risk of ankle injuries and facilitating quick directional changes characteristic of Zumba. Standard shoes may lack these features, increasing the potential for musculoskeletal strain.

Question 3: How does the choice of fabric impact the effectiveness of a Zumba workout?

Fabric selection significantly influences comfort and temperature regulation. Moisture-wicking materials, such as polyester blends, facilitate the evaporation of sweat, preventing overheating and maintaining a more stable core body temperature. Conversely, absorbent fabrics like cotton retain moisture, potentially leading to discomfort and increased risk of skin irritation.

Question 4: What considerations should guide the selection of appropriate undergarments for a Zumba workout?

Undergarments should prioritize support, comfort, and moisture management. Supportive sports bras are essential for minimizing breast movement and preventing discomfort during high-impact activities. Moisture-wicking fabrics in both bras and briefs reduce the risk of chafing and skin irritation.

Question 5: How does layering impact the overall Zumba workout experience?

Strategic layering allows for adaptability to varying environmental conditions and fluctuations in body temperature. A lightweight outer layer can provide insulation during the warm-up and cool-down phases, while breathable base layers promote moisture evaporation during high-intensity intervals. This modular approach optimizes comfort and prevents overheating or excessive cooling.

Question 6: Are there specific clothing styles or cuts that are best avoided during Zumba workouts?

Restrictive clothing, such as tight jeans or overly constricting tops, should be avoided as they can impede movement and limit range of motion. Similarly, excessively loose clothing may pose a tripping hazard. Apparel should conform comfortably to the body without restricting agility.
